Hyundai Azera: A/C Pressure Transducer Repair procedures
| Inspection |
| 1. |
Measure the pressure of high pressure line by measuring voltage output between NO.1 and NO.2 terminals.
|
| 2. |
Inspect the voltage value whether it is sufficient to be regular value or not.
|
| 3. |
If the measured voltage value is not specification, replace the A/C pressure transducer. |
| Replacement |
| 1. |
Disconnect the negative (-) battery terminal. |
| 2. |
Recover the refrigerant with a recovery/charging station. |
| 3. |
Disconnect the A/C pressure transducer connector (A) and then remove the A/C pressure transducer (B).
|
| 4. |
Installation is the reverse order of removal. |
